The Role of Hardware Verification

Hardware verification serves as a protective barrier between users and potential cyber risks. By requiring physical confirmation on the device, Trezor helps prevent unauthorized access attempts that may originate from compromised computers or deceptive websites.

Every login request undergoes an additional layer of review, ensuring that actions are approved only by the rightful wallet owner.


Authentication Process Overview

Device Connection

Users connect their Trezor hardware wallet to a compatible computer. Once connected, the system establishes a secure communication channel between the device and wallet management software.

Identity Confirmation

The device displays authentication information that allows users to verify the legitimacy of the request before proceeding.

Approval Stage

After reviewing the details, users authorize the request directly on the hardware wallet. This confirmation process strengthens account protection by requiring physical interaction.

Wallet Access

Following successful verification, users can securely access account features, portfolio information, and cryptocurrency management tools.


Core Security Benefits

Secure Key Storage

Private keys remain protected within the hardware wallet and are never exposed during the login process.

Reduced Online Risk

Because approvals take place on the physical device, attackers have fewer opportunities to interfere with authentication activities.

Trusted User Verification

The login system ensures that account access requires possession of the registered hardware wallet.

Enhanced Transaction Safety

Important actions can be reviewed and confirmed before execution, helping users maintain greater control over their funds.
